Positive Service Gets Positive Results―Every Time!
Customer loyalty is becoming harder to establish and just as difficult tomaintain. This is truer than ever in today’s hyperdigital world, where a singlecustomer venting his or her dissatisfaction on a blog or social network canamass an army of anti-you activists―and send your business spiraling.
The Customer Signs Your Paycheck reveals the secret to ensuring customercontentment during every interaction. Inside, Frank Cooper examines theelements at the heart of quality customer service, which begin with selfawarenessand confidence. You’ll learn:
You’ll immediately take note of dramatic changes in the way you deal withdifficult personalities, customer complaints, and other challenges that comewith the territory.
Why drive customers to the competition? It really is easy to provide superbservice, even when dealing with today’s highly empowered and demandingcustomer.
